I have a 99 audi a4 1.8t quattro. The fuel gauge is baffling me. When the tank is full it will read full until it gets to about 3/4 tank, then it gets odd. Once at 3/4 tank it will sometimes drop to completely empty, it goes to empty completely random. Once the car gets to half a tank it only reads properly when i rev the car up.. weird right?

so basicaly it reads good till about half a tank tp 3/4 ish, then only starts to read randomly or when its revved up..
once it gets lower than half it just drops dead and im left clueless

fuel level sending unit: a little wire broke on it and needs to be replaced and re-soldered. there was a diy somewhere out there, probably the easiest job you will ever do on your audi. buy a little piece of wire around 1" long and solder it on there or you can just buy a new fuel level sending unit which will cost you over $100 LOL
